Fractal Analytics slips after Q1 PAT drops 38% QoQ to Rs 72 crore
Mumbai, July 24 -- Revenue from operations increased 2.96% quarter on quarter (QoQ) to Rs 912.5 crore in Q1 FY27.
On a year-on-year (YoY) basis, the company reported a 92% surge in consolidated net profit to Rs 72.3 crore, while revenue from operations increased 20% to Rs 912.5 crore in Q1 FY27 compared with Q1 FY26.
Consumer Packaged Goods and Retail (CPGR) continued to gather momentum, growing 19% YoY. On the other hand, TMT declined 22% YoY.
Fractal's focus on deepening customer relationships continues to yield good outcomes. Its clients collectively increased their spending with the company, as reflected in the Net Revenue Retention (NRR) of 117% in Q1. Further, its Net Promoter Score (NPS) during the period stood at 77.
